[Remote] Supervision Consultant
Note: The job is a remote job and is open to candidates in USA. Empower is focused on transforming financial lives by providing a flexible work environment and promoting internal mobility. As a Supervision Consultant, you will oversee the supervision of Registered Representatives, ensure compliance with regulatory requirements, and contribute to process improvements within the team.
Responsibilities
- Provide effective supervision and coaching to sales team management, addressing call reviews, escalations, and complaint handling
- Collaborate with Compliance, HR, and management to recommend and monitor individuals requiring additional supervision
- Prepare regular reports on supervisory trends and activities, executing plans for issue remediation
- Conduct self-audits of branch office records and reviews of electronic and written communications
- Provide backup support to other department teams, including call quality reviews, participating in calibrations and disputes, and performing suitability and trade reviews as needed
- Partner with Training, Compliance, and Legal staff to develop and maintain supervisory policies, procedures, and training resources. Provide training to relevant stakeholders
Skills
- Bachelor's Degree preferred in a business or finance-related field, or equivalent work experience
- At least 3 years of experience in the retail financial services industry
- Knowledge and experience in regulatory compliance and/or supervision
- FINRA Series 7, Series 24, and Series 51 registrations required. Permissible additional registrations may include 63, 65/66
- Intermediate skill level MS Word, MS Excel, and MS PowerPoint
- Detail oriented with proven technical skills
- Strong motivational and interpersonal skills
- Demonstrated ability to work both independently and within a collaborative team environment
